How Often Should You Clean Your Pool Filter?
Signs your filter needs cleaning:
-
Pressure gauge reads 8 to 10 PSI higher than normal
-
Water flow from pool jets is weak
-
Pool water looks cloudy
-
Pump is working harder than usual
-
Filter has not been cleaned in 3 to 6 months
In Tomball, TX, plan on a filter cleaning every 3 to 6 months — sooner if you spot the signs above.

How We Clean Your Pool Filter
-
Inspect the system first. Pressure, water flow, and the filter’s condition. If the real problem is a worn pump or damaged part, we say so before any work starts.
-
Break it down. Cartridges or grids come out and every element gets cleaned individually, along with the housing — not sprayed off in place.
-
Give it a proper acid bath. A hose rinse clears surface debris and nothing else. The acid bath strips out the oils and minerals baked into the pleats — that’s what restores filtration and flow.
-
Check for wear. Cartridges last 2 to 3 years with proper cleaning. If yours is torn or past its life, we’ll say so — and only recommend what the pool needs.
-
Reassemble and verify. Everything goes back together, the system runs, and we confirm pressure is down and flow is back.

Why isn’t rinsing the filter with a garden hose good enough?
A hose rinse only knocks off surface debris. The oils and minerals that choke a filter stay baked into the pleats. A proper acid bath strips them out — that’s the method we use on every Tomball filter cleaning.
